Output e0c6b5ae56c521c209d0a2baa1c9beec80098e9a7e22f392066a0c5202712ee2:0

value
580511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1f3bed9b3a74b6b1dc39b266fcd285572d59e6 OP_EQUAL
address
3HHptXg5miWzC4uzXGznDujTnsU7UKD8sc
transaction
e0c6b5ae56c521c209d0a2baa1c9beec80098e9a7e22f392066a0c5202712ee2
confirmations
185561
spent
true